The Orange County Health Department welcomes all clients requesting health services, regardless of their immigration status. For more information about our services, please call (919) 245-2400. If you speak Spanish only, please call (919)644-3350 and leave a voicemail message. Someone who speaks Spanish will return your call. We want our clients to know that we follow all applicable medical confidentiality laws, which protect their information.

Opportunities to Get Involved
The Health Department also facilitates a local Latino Health Coalition and Refugee Health Coalition to encourage interagency communication and collaboration on issues related to the health of local immigrants and refugees. New members are welcome!
